Subject: [PATCH v5 00/19] libxl: improvements, prep for subprocess handling

This is the initial portion of my child process series which has been
acked and which I intend to apply right away.  Changes are exactly
those discussed on the list since v4; I'm reposting the final version
for form's sake.

Bugfixes for problems reported by Roger Pau Monne:
 02/19 libxl: ao: allow immediate completion
 03/19 libxl: fix hang due to libxl__initiate_device_remove
 04/19 libxl: Fix eventloop_iteration over-locking
 05/19 libxl: remove poller from list in libxl__poller_get

Other general bugfixes:
 01/19 .gitignore: Add a missing file
 06/19 libxl: Fix leak of ctx->lock
 07/19 tools: Correct PTHREAD options in config/StdGNU.mk
 08/19 libxl: Use PTHREAD_CFLAGS, LDFLAGS, LIBS
 09/19 tools: Use PTHREAD_CFLAGS, _LDFLAGS, _LIBS

Clarifications and improvements related to memory allocation:
 10/19 libxl: Crash (more sensibly) on malloc failure
 11/19 libxl: Make libxl__zalloc et al tolerate a NULL gc

Preparatory work for child process handling:
 12/19 libxl: Introduce some convenience macros
 13/19 libxl: include <ctype.h> and introduce CTYPE helper macro
 14/19 libxl: Provide libxl_string_list_length
 15/19 libxl: include <_libxl_paths.h> in libxl_internal.h
 16/19 libxl: abolish libxl_ctx_postfork

Event-related infrastructure and fixes:
 17/19 libxl: libxl_event.c:beforepoll_internal, REQUIRE_FDS
 18/19 libxl: Protect fds with CLOEXEC even with forking threads
 19/19 libxl: provide STATE_AO_GC

The remaining patches (20-31 from v4) remain outstanding.
